"General Problems of Shades and Shadows" by Edward Warren explores the principles of descriptive geometry as applied to architectural and technical drawing. This comprehensive guide provides a systematic approach to understanding and solving problems related to shades and shadows, essential for architects, designers, and students. Warren's clear explanations and detailed illustrations make complex concepts accessible, offering readers a strong foundation in spatial visualization and precise rendering techniques.

Originally published as part of a broader series on technical arts, this volume focuses specifically on the geometric principles that govern how light interacts with three-dimensional forms. This book remains a valuable resource for anyone seeking a deeper understanding of the interplay between light, form, and representation in design.
